Отключите все лишнее на целевой странице если она одна, это реально сделать - например скрипты всяких фейсбуков, сторонней аналитики и так далее. Обычно сервесы используют много сторонних скриптов, которые не влияют на работу сайта, но сильно нагружают проц.
Смотрите как идет распределение нагрузки - возможно оно не сплашное, а пиками - тогда можно попробовать запускать потоки более равномерно. Чтоб избегать этих пиков.
Чаще всего можно отрисовку снизить вплоть до 10 (ну 20) .... На загрузку проца, это как раз сильно влияет.
Если сервер свой и без видюхи, то стоит поставить в него видюху.
50 в нынешних условиях для баса с браузером, достаточно много. Можно попробовать разбить на несколько копий баса по 25 например.
Можно использовать рам диск для работы с профилями - но это уже продвинутый уровень.
CSS и произвольный выбор
-
Есть строка >CSS> #vote > :nth-child(1) - отвечает за выбор первой строки
Соответственно, >CSS> #vote > :nth-child(2) - отвечает за выбор второй строки и т.д.
Мне нужно, чтобы выбор строки был случайным. Предварительно генерирую число в определённом диапазоне и сохраняю в переменную RANDOM.
По шаблону >CSS> #vote > :nth-child([[RANDOM]]), но в CSS селекторе так не работает.
Какие ещё есть варианты, чтобы был рандомный выбор с подстановкой случайного значения, чтобы элемент выбирался по заданному шаблону?
А также, если элемента с таким числом не существует, например, >CSS> #vote > :nth-child(5), то пропускалось это и продолжал перебирать значения до тех пор, пока не найдёт существующий элемент и так по циклу. -
@IdAlexBlack случайное число и так заносится в переменную, а эта переменную я вставлял в вышеуказанный шаблон, но это не работает.
Я точно не могу знать, какие мне подходят значение, какие нет, есть только конкретный дипазон, например, от 0 до 9. Так и нужно в цикле все перебирать элементы с числами от 0 до 9. Несуществующие элементы пропускать, на существующие нажимать и далее по циклу.